#c42115 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c42115 is composed of 76.9% red, 12.9%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.2% magenta, 89.3%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 4.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 42.5%. #c42115 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ff422a with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#c42115
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defee is the lightest one.

Tones of #c42115
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716968 is the less saturated color, while #d51304 is the most saturated one.
